We are just out of the warranty of this dishwsher and now have another
problem.
When we turn it on, it goes through the prewash cycle, and empties.
Then once it begins the wash cycle it stops and it sounds as though the
motor is trying to start but failing. We have checked that there is
nothing caught and emptied everything out but still no luck. The light
on the prewash remains solid green but if you leave it long enough the
wash light flashes green.
Any ideas of what could be causing this?

You could check the motor brushes to see if they are worn down. I had a
problem with a washing machine that would stop occasionally and not get
going again, yet if you took the back off and ( carefully ) spun the drum
drive wheel aroud, the motor would burst into life, accompanied by a fair
amount of sparking ( due to the poor brush/commutator contact ). Remember to
pull the plug out if you're poking around inside with the brushes.
